Inductive reasoning: characterized by drawing a general conclusion (make a conjecture) from repeated observations of specific examples. the conjecture may or may not be true. counterexample: an example that does not work, used in order to prove a conjecture incorrect. Inductive reasoning is reason based on patterns, as opposed to rules, which is deductive reasoning. inductive reasoning provides conjectures, which are conclusions based on inductive reasoning. geometry includes making conjectures and conducting proofs, which involve making deductions through a series of observational steps.
